T20 World Cup: Pakistan Bow Out With a Thrilling Victory

©X T20WorldCup

Pakistan emerged victorious over Ireland by a margin of 3 wickets in their final match of the T20 World Cup 2024 at the Central Broward Regional Park Stadium Turf Ground, Lauderhill, Florida, on Sunday. Opting to bat first, Ireland struggled, managing only 106/9 in their allotted 20 overs. Babar Azam and his team successfully chased down the target with 7 balls to spare, concluding their campaign on a positive note.

Ireland’s innings began disastrously, losing multiple wickets in the initial overs. Balbirnie (0 off 3), Paul Stirling (1 off 3), Lorcan Tucker (2 off 2), Harry Tector (0 off 6), and George Dockrell (11 off 10) found themselves at sea against the Pakistani bowlers, returning to the pavilion within the powerplay. Half of Ireland’s team was dismissed, with the scoreboard showing 28/5 in 5.4 overs.

Gareth Delany (31 off 19) injected some momentum into Ireland’s innings, while Joshua Little contributed an unbeaten 22 runs, helping Ireland reach a total of just above 100 runs.

Pakistan’s bowling attack was exceptional, led by Shaheen Afridi (3/22) and Imad Wasim (3/8). Mohammad Amir (2/11) and Haris Rauf (1/17) also contributed significantly to restrict Ireland.

Mohammad Rizwan (17 off 16) and Saim Ayub (17 off 17) made a steady start for Pakistan, but the middle order faltered, reminiscent of their game against India. Captain Babar Azam (32* off 34) anchored the innings, supported by Abbas Afridi (17 off 21) and Shaheen Afridi (13* off 5), guiding Pakistan to victory.

Barry McCarthy was outstanding for Ireland with 3 wickets for 15 runs in his 4 overs. Curtis Campher (2/24), Mark Adair (1/24), and Benjamin White (1/11) also contributed with the ball.

Key Moments of the Match:

Shaheen Afridi’s early breakthroughs

Shaheen Afridi, bowling with the new ball, made an immediate impact. He dismissed Andrew Balbirnie on the third delivery of the match and then removed Lorcan Tucker, putting Ireland under pressure from the start.

Gareth Delany’s impactful innings

Facing a daunting situation, Gareth Delany played aggressively, scoring 31 runs off 19 balls with three sixes and a four, providing crucial impetus to Ireland’s innings.

©PakistanCricket

Imad Wasim’s pivotal spell

Gareth Delany was on the attack, but Imad Wasim halted his progress by dismissing him and taking two more wickets, finishing with impressive figures of 3/8 in his 4 overs.

McCarthy & Campher disrupt Pakistan’s middle-order

Despite Pakistan looking comfortable in their chase at 52/2 after 8 overs, Barry McCarthy and Curtis Campher created a stir by dismissing four Pakistani batsmen in quick succession, tightening the game.

Shaheen Afridi’s decisive contribution

In a match where timing the ball was challenging, Shaheen Afridi stood out by smashing two crucial sixes in the penultimate over, sealing Pakistan’s victory in style.

Pakistan’s T20 World Cup journey was mixed, winning two out of four matches in the group stage and finishing third in Group A, failing to advance to the Super 8s.

Meanwhile, Ireland struggled throughout the tournament, failing to secure a single win in four matches, with one match abandoned due to rain. Paul Stirling’s side finished at the bottom of Group A.
